helpstartblogstalkscontacts
old postsupdatestagswho we are

Boost Your Immune System with Plant-Based Foods

14 November 2025

Let’s be real—nobody enjoys getting sick. Whether it's the sniffles, a stubborn cough, or something more serious, a weak immune system can throw your entire life off balance. So, what if I told you there’s a powerful, natural way to supercharge your immune system? Yep, you guessed it—plant-based foods.

Now, I’m not saying you have to go full herbivore overnight. But loading up your plate with more greens, fruits, legumes, nuts, and seeds might just be the immune-boosting magic your body’s been craving.

In this article, we’ll dig into how plant-based foods can strengthen your immune system, why your gut plays a leading role in immunity, and which specific plant foods are your immune system’s best friends.

Boost Your Immune System with Plant-Based Foods

Why Your Immune System Needs a Boost

Before we dive into the rainbow of plant-based goodies, let’s take a quick peek at your immune system. Think of it as your body’s personal security system. When it’s running smoothly, it fights off viruses, bacteria, and other invaders like a boss.

But here’s the kicker—stress, lack of sleep, and a nutrient-poor diet (hello processed junk food) can weaken your immune system, leaving you wide open for illness. That’s where a healthy lifestyle, especially nutrition, comes in.

Boost Your Immune System with Plant-Based Foods

The Immune System and Nutrition: The Undeniable Link

You know the saying, “You are what you eat”? Well, your immune system takes that quite literally. Your immune cells need specific nutrients to function properly. Without them, it’s like trying to fight a battle with no weapons.

Plant-based foods are jam-packed with the vitamins, minerals, antioxidants, and fiber your body needs to build a strong defense system. Think of them as nature’s medicine cabinet.

Still not convinced? Keep reading.
Boost Your Immune System with Plant-Based Foods

Power of Plants: What Makes Plant-Based Foods So Special?

Plants are the OG multitaskers. They're not just low-cal and high-fiber; they’re also full of natural compounds that help your body thrive. Here's what makes them a game-changer for your immunity.

✳️ Rich in Antioxidants

Ever heard of free radicals? No, they’re not some rogue political group—they're unstable molecules that damage your cells and speed up aging. Antioxidants (like vitamin C, E, and beta-carotene) fight these bad boys off.

Fruits like berries, oranges, and kiwis; veggies like spinach, bell peppers, and sweet potatoes—they’re all antioxidant gold mines.

✳️ Packed With Vitamins and Minerals

Plant foods deliver a serious vitamin punch. Vitamin C (citrus fruits), zinc (pumpkin seeds), selenium (Brazil nuts), and iron (chickpeas and lentils) are all major players in immune health.

Your immune cells basically rely on these nutrients like a car needs fuel to run.

✳️ Rich in Fiber for a Healthy Gut

Here’s a fun fact: roughly 70% of your immune system lives in your gut. Yep, your gastrointestinal tract is home to trillions of bacteria (known as your gut microbiome), and they play a massive role in immunity.

Fiber from plant foods feeds these good bacteria, helping to keep your gut—and therefore your immune system—in tip-top shape.

✳️ Anti-Inflammatory Compounds

Inflammation is your body’s natural response to injury or infection. But chronic inflammation? That’s bad news. It can weaken immune function and lead to disease.

Luckily, many plant foods (like turmeric, ginger, leafy greens, and berries) have powerful anti-inflammatory properties that help cool things down.
Boost Your Immune System with Plant-Based Foods

Top Immune-Boosting Plant-Based Foods You Need Right Now

So, which foods should you be stocking your fridge with? Let's break down the MVPs of immune-boosting plant-based nutrition.

🥦 1. Leafy Greens (Spinach, Kale, Swiss Chard)

These green giants are loaded with vitamins A, C, K, magnesium, and folate. Spinach, in particular, also has immune-boosting beta-carotene and antioxidants that increase infection-fighting blood cells.

Want to power up a smoothie or salad? A handful of greens is a delicious way to do it.

🫐 2. Berries (Blueberries, Strawberries, Raspberries)

These tiny fruits pack a big punch. Rich in vitamin C and antioxidants like flavonoids, berries help your immune system fight off illnesses and reduce oxidative stress.

Plus, they taste like candy—but without all the guilt.

🧄 3. Garlic and Onions

They may make you cry while chopping, but garlic and onions are your immune system’s besties. Filled with sulfur-containing compounds (like allicin), these foods have antimicrobial and antiviral properties.

Bonus: They add a ton of flavor to dishes, so no need to drown your food in salt or sugar.

🥕 4. Carrots and Sweet Potatoes

Orange foods = beta-carotene buzz! Your body converts this antioxidant into vitamin A, which helps keep your skin and mucous membranes (your body’s first barrier to pathogens) healthy and strong.

Think of it as building a brick wall of protection from the inside out.

🥑 5. Avocados

Creamy, dreamy, and nutrient-packed, avocados are rich in healthy fats that support cell function, along with vitamin E—an important antioxidant for immune health.

So yes, go ahead with that avocado toast. It’s doctor-approved.

🌰 6. Nuts and Seeds (Almonds, Walnuts, Sunflower Seeds, Pumpkin Seeds)

These crunchy snacks are immune powerhouses. They’re full of vitamin E, zinc, selenium, and omega-3s—nutrients essential for supporting immune cell structure and function.

Keep a small bag on hand for a quick, immune-loving snack.

🍊 7. Citrus Fruits (Oranges, Lemons, Grapefruits)

Vitamin C is practically the poster child for immune support, and citrus fruits are famous for it. It helps white blood cells function better and shortens the duration of cold symptoms.

Squeeze some lemon into your water or enjoy a juicy orange for a refreshing immunity boost.

🌶️ 8. Bell Peppers

Surprise: Bell peppers have more vitamin C than oranges! Plus, they’re rich in beta-carotene for healthy skin and tissues.

Toss them into salads, stir-fries, or just snack on slices with hummus. Easy peasy.

🫘 9. Legumes (Lentils, Chickpeas, Beans)

These plant-based proteins deliver iron, zinc, magnesium, and folate—nutrients your immune system craves to stay sharp.

They're also loaded with fiber to feed your gut microbiome. Try adding lentils to soups or tossing chickpeas into salads.

☕ 10. Green Tea

Okay, technically not a food, but green tea deserves a shout-out. It’s full of antioxidants called catechins, which have antiviral and anti-inflammatory properties.

Sip on a warm mug daily for a gentle pick-me-up that your immune system will thank you for.

Supercharge Your Immune System with These Easy Tips

You’ve got your plant-based foods lined up—awesome! Now let's make them work even harder for you. Here are some tips to boost their impact.

✅ Mix Up the Colors

Each color in fruits and vegetables represents different nutrients. So go ahead and eat the rainbow—your immune system will love the variety.

✅ Eat Whole, Less Processed Foods

Minimize highly processed foods and prioritize whole, fresh ingredients. The closer to nature, the better.

✅ Stay Consistent

No, eating a spinach salad once won’t magically make you immune to colds. Consistency is key. Fueling your body daily with nutrient-dense foods builds long-term defense.

✅ Hydrate Like a Champ

Water helps transport nutrients throughout your body. Staying hydrated ensures your immune cells function properly.

What About Supplements?

Supplements can be helpful, especially if you have a deficiency, but they shouldn't replace food. Whole foods contain a complex mix of nutrients and fiber that can’t be replicated in a pill.

Think of supplements as a backup dancer—useful, but not the star of the show.

Final Thoughts: Eat Plants, Feel Powerful

At the end of the day, your immune system is only as strong as the fuel you give it. Plant-based foods aren’t just trendy—they’re time-tested nutrition powerhouses with real benefits.

So next time you're at the grocery store, stock up on those vibrant fruits, hearty legumes, and colorful veggies. Your taste buds and your immune system will high-five you.

Seriously, eating more plants is one of the simplest, most powerful things you can do for your health. And hey, even if you’re not 100% plant-based, every step counts. Start small, stay consistent, and let your food do the healing.

Stay healthy, stay happy—and pass the guac, please!

all images in this post were generated using AI tools


Category:

Plant Based Diet

Author:

Tiffany Foster

Tiffany Foster


Discussion

rate this article


0 comments


helpstartblogstalkscontacts

Copyright © 2025 SlimVib.com

Founded by: Tiffany Foster

old postsupdatestagseditor's choicewho we are
usagecookie settingsdata policy